The window service market for residents of CID, NC, is characterized by reliance on regional contractors from the Shelby and greater Charlotte areas. The competition is strong among these providers, ensuring a good range of options from budget-friendly vinyl replacements (e.g., Window World) to high-end custom solutions (e.g., Renewal by Andersen). **Quality and Competition:** The average quality of service is high, as these established companies rely on strong reputations and reviews. They compete on product quality, energy efficiency, price, and customer service.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is competitive but varies significantly based on the window material and project scope. * **Budget-Friendly Vinyl Window Replacement:** A full-home installation can range from **$5,000 - $15,000**. * **Mid-Range Composite or Wood-Clad Windows:** Projects typically range from **$15,000 - $30,000**. * **High-End Custom & Specialty Windows:** Projects can exceed **$30,000**, depending on the size, materials, and complexity. Given the climate in North Carolina, there is a strong emphasis on energy-efficient windows to reduce cooling costs in the summer and improve home comfort year-round. For a standard-sized home in CID, a full window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000, depending on the number of windows, materials (vinyl, wood, fiberglass), and energy efficiency features. Local pricing is influenced by North Carolina's climate demands, as homeowners often invest in Low-E glass and argon gas fills to manage both summer heat and occasional winter cold snaps effectively. Always get itemized quotes from local installers that include removal, installation, and disposal.
Yes, CID follows North Carolina's statewide building codes, which may require a permit for window replacements if the structural opening is being altered. For standard like-for-like replacements, a permit is often not needed, but this can vary by local municipality within the CID area. It is crucial to hire a licensed North Carolina contractor who will verify and handle all local permit requirements, ensuring compliance with energy efficiency and safety standards specific to our region.
The ideal times for window installation in CID are during the mild spring and fall seasons, avoiding the peak summer humidity and heat, as well as occasional winter frosts. These temperate periods allow for proper sealing and curing of caulks and adhesives. Scheduling in these off-peak seasons can also lead to better installer availability and potential promotional pricing from local companies.
Prioritize companies that are licensed, insured, and have strong local references in CID. Look for installers with specific experience handling the high humidity and storm potential of North Carolina, offering products with strong warranties against seal failure and water intrusion. Check their standing with the North Carolina Licensing Board for General Contractors and seek those who provide a detailed, in-home assessment rather than just a phone quote.
In CID's humid climate, the most common issues are condensation between panes (indicating seal failure) and water infiltration around the frame after heavy rains. A proper installation by a local professional will include meticulous flashing and sealing tailored to withstand North Carolina's weather. Reputable installers will address these under their workmanship warranty, which is why choosing a company with a strong local service reputation is critical for long-term performance.
